OpenAI Codex · 小白一条龙教程

把 fululai API 接入 Codex CLI

Codex CLI 是 OpenAI 官方的本地 AI 编程工具:你在项目文件夹里输入 codex,它就能理解代码、解释项目、修 Bug、执行代码任务。本页带你从安装到用 fululai 跑通第一个任务。

Codex 是什么? AI 编程助手

它运行在你电脑本地,可以读取当前项目,帮你解释代码、写功能、修 Bug、跑命令。

fululai 的作用 模型来源

fululai 提供 API Key、模型和余额。通过 CC Switch 或配置文件,让 Codex 走 fululai。

难度提醒

Codex 主要用终端启动。新手不用写代码,只需要复制命令、粘贴、回车。

使用工具前的准备事项

最简单:CC Switch 一键导入 fululai,然后启动 Codex

Codex 官方默认推荐 ChatGPT 登录,也支持 API Key。小白如果手动配置,容易卡在 Key、Base URL、模型名和配置文件。推荐先用 CC Switch 导入 fululai,再让 Codex 使用这套配置。

准备 A:安装 CC Switch

它像“AI 编程工具配置管家”,统一管理 fululai API。

CC Switch 教程

准备 B:创建 API Key

进入 fululai 控制台 → API 密钥,创建并复制 Key。

打开 API Key 页面

准备 C:导入到 CCS

点击 API Key 行里的「导入到 CCS」,再在 CC Switch 里激活 fululai。

之后重启终端
为什么推荐这样?
因为 Codex 的配置可能涉及 ~/.codex/config.toml、API Key 登录、模型供应商等概念。CC Switch 可以把这些复杂配置包装成“选择 fululai 并启用”。

启动 Codex:按这 4 步走

开始前:先完成上面的准备事项:安装 CC Switch → 创建 API Key → 导入到 CCS。完成后,再按下面步骤启动 Codex。
  1. 打开终端。
  2. 复制 Codex 官方安装命令,粘贴到终端,按回车。
  3. 进入你想让 AI 帮忙的项目文件夹。
  4. 运行启动命令,复制本页第一个任务模板测试。

第一步:终端是什么?

终端就是电脑里的“命令输入框”。本页命令不是让你写代码,只是把官方安装器或启动指令复制进去。

macOS

Command + 空格,输入「终端」或 Terminal,回车打开。

Windows

普通方式:按 Windows 键,搜索「PowerShell」或「终端 / Windows Terminal」,回车打开。
Codex 更推荐:官方文档写的是 Windows 11 通过 WSL2 使用;装过 WSL2 的用户,打开「Ubuntu」应用再复制命令。不会区分的话,先按普通方式尝试;不行再切换 WSL2。

第二步:安装 Codex CLI

官方 Quickstart 推荐两种全局安装方式:npm 或 Homebrew。安装完成后输入 codex 启动。

方式 A:npm 安装

npm install -g @openai/codex
如果提示 npm 不存在:说明你还没装 Node.js。先去下载中心或 Node.js 官网安装 Node,再重新打开终端。

方式 B:Homebrew 安装(macOS 常用)

brew install --cask codex

方式 C:GitHub Release 下载(备用)

如果你会分辨系统架构,可以从官方 Release 下载对应文件;小白优先用 npm/Homebrew。

系统通常下载说明
macOS Apple Siliconcodex-aarch64-apple-darwin.tar.gzM1/M2/M3/M4 Mac
macOS Intelcodex-x86_64-apple-darwin.tar.gz较老的 Intel Mac
Linux x86_64codex-x86_64-unknown-linux-musl.tar.gz常见 Linux 服务器/电脑
Linux arm64codex-aarch64-unknown-linux-musl.tar.gzARM Linux
打开 Codex 最新 Release
不要下载 Source code.zip
Source code 是源码,不是给小白直接安装的软件。Release 里文件很多,小白优先用 npm 或 Homebrew。

第三步:接入 fululai API

Codex 接入 fululai 本质上就是让它知道:API Key、服务地址、模型名。

API Key

你的账号通行证,长得像 sk-...

去复制 Key

Base URL

https://api.fululai.cn/v1

推荐模型

gpt-5.5
gpt-5.5-codex

方式 A:推荐用 CC Switch

  1. 在 fululai API Key 页面点击「导入到 CCS」。
  2. 打开 CC Switch,确认 fululai 供应商已导入。
  3. 选择/激活 fululai。
  4. 关闭当前终端,重新打开,再输入 codex

方式 B:Codex 官方 API Key 登录

官方说明:Codex 默认推荐用 ChatGPT 登录,也支持 API Key。若走 API Key,需要额外配置。新手优先用 CC Switch。

codex

启动后如果看到登录选择,优先确认 CC Switch 已经激活 fululai;如果选择 API Key,就填 fululai 的 Key,并确认服务地址/模型使用 fululai 配置。

方式 C:高级用户配置文件思路

Codex Rust CLI 使用 ~/.codex/config.toml。如果你会编辑配置文件,可以按 fululai 提供的 Codex/OpenAI 兼容配置填写模型供应商;不会就不要手动改,避免写错。

# 高级示意,不建议小白直接照抄 # ~/.codex/config.toml # model = "gpt-5.5" # model_provider = "fululai" # [model_providers.fululai] # base_url = "https://api.fululai.cn/v1" # env_key = "OPENAI_API_KEY"
安全提醒:API Key 不要发群里、不要截图外泄。页面里的示例不是你的真实 Key。

第四步:打开项目文件夹并启动 Codex

Codex 最适合在“项目文件夹”里运行。比如你有一个网站项目,就先进入那个文件夹。

项目文件夹是什么?
就是放代码、网页、配置文件的文件夹。Codex 会读取这个文件夹里的内容,帮你理解和修改。

如果你已经在项目文件夹里

codex

如果你还不知道怎么进入文件夹

可以先把项目文件夹拖进终端窗口,终端会自动出现路径。也可以先把项目放到桌面,按示例路径尝试。

cd 你的项目文件夹路径 codex

第五步:复制第一个任务模板测试

第一次不要让它直接大改代码,先让它只分析:

请先不要修改任何文件。请用小白能听懂的话检查当前项目结构,告诉我:1)这个项目可能是做什么的;2)主要文件夹分别是什么;3)如果我要做一个小改动,应该先从哪里开始。
通过标准:如果它能说清楚项目结构,说明安装、启动和模型连接基本正常。之后再让它修 Bug、改页面、写功能。

常见问题:看到这些不要慌

问题/报错是什么意思怎么解决
codex: command not foundCodex 没装好,或终端没刷新。关闭终端重新打开;仍不行就重新运行 npm/Homebrew 安装命令。
npm: command not found没有安装 Node.js。先安装 Node.js,再重新打开终端。
401 / UnauthorizedAPI Key 不对、没填或复制多了空格。回 fululai 控制台重新复制 Key,再导入/配置。
余额不足fululai 账号没有可用余额。去充值页小额充值后再试。
model not found模型名不匹配。先用 gpt-5.5 或 CC Switch 推荐模型测试。
一直让登录 ChatGPTCodex 还在走官方 ChatGPT 登录,没有读取 fululai 配置。重启终端,检查 CC Switch 是否激活;必要时重新导入 CCS 并重启终端。
Windows 不知道怎么装官方要求 Windows 11 via WSL2。先装 WSL2,或联系查看教程;不要直接乱下 Release 文件。
它要修改文件,我怕出错Codex 可以改文件,所以第一次要限制它。先用“不要修改任何文件,只分析”的任务模板。